Welcome to Season 5, Episode 10 of Winning Isn't Easy. In this episode, we'll dive into the complicated topic of "Conditions That Might Be Subject to Term Limitations or Exclusions – Understanding Them, and Why."
Join attorney Nancy L. Cavey, a leading expert in disability claims, for an insightful discussion on medical conditions that may be subject to term limitations or exclusions. Many prospective disability applicants believe that if they have a medical condition and a doctor confirms they are disabled, they have an open-and-shut case. Unfortunately, this is often not the case - particularly when the disability is mental in nature, or when a physical disability is partially linked to a mental health condition. In today’s session, Nancy L. Cavey will explore a range of medical conditions that could be subject to these limitations or exclusions and explain why.
In this episode, we'll cover the following topics:
One - Drug Addiction / Substance Abuse and Your ERISA Disability Claim
Two - Alzheimer’s Disease and Your ERISA Disability Insurance Claim
Three - Gender Dysphoria and Your ERISA Disability Insurance Claim
